If you are booking for a flight relatively soon then it's a good choice but they are still going through some growing pains.
Rapid expansion into new smaller market. They will cancel a lot of routes that are "seasonal" months out based on lack of demand.

Similar to Frontier, Spirit and Jet Blue. Some growing pains. The employees need some more training on professionalism as they were a little silly and cavalier at the gates. You have to pay for luggage and for seat selection so get one up front if you are only doing a carry on bag. The overhead can fill up. Charleston to NOLA is quick, direct and fairly inexpensive.

Have flown MCO to HSV and MSY a few times. New Airbus A220 planes. Their best seats (equivalent to 1st class) are very reasonable. I'm a fan - however, their flight schedule is a little thin meaning if your flight is cancelled you may have to wait a few days for the next flight.
